Details of IFSC Code for Bank Of Baroda, New Panvel, Thane
Here are the main details that are associated with the IFSC Code BARB0VJNPAN of Bank Of Baroda for its branch located in Thane, within the district of Navi Mumbai in the state of Maharashtra.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Bank Of Baroda |
| IFSC Code | BARB0VJNPAN |
| Branch | New Panvel |
| City | Thane |
| District | Navi Mumbai |
| State | Maharashtra |
| Address | P B No 32 , Shiva Complex,Sect19 , Post Office Road , Navi Mumbai , 410206 |

What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?
I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, an 11-character alphanumeric code provided by the Reserve Bank of India. Every bank branch, including Bank Of Baroda located in New Panvel, Thane, Maharashtra, is provided with a unique IFSC like BARB0VJNPAN to ensure that online payments reach the right destination.
The IFSC Code is important because:
- It uniquely identifies the Bank Of Baroda branch in Thane.
- It hel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
- It avoids any errors or confusions between multiple branches of the same bank across different places like Thane and Navi Mumbai.
- It reduces errors in fund transfers and improves accuracy.
- It allows sender banks to validate and confirm branch details before processing payments.
There are thousands of branches across Maharashtra and the rest of India and the IFSC Code ensures that transactions meant for Bank Of Baroda in New Panvel do not get mixed with another location.
Format of the IFSC Code BARB0VJNPAN
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Bank Of Baroda,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): These represent the bank code. In Bank Of Baroda, they are a short identifier for the bank.
- 5th character (0): This is always zero and is reserved for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): These are what represent the specific branch code which is assigned to branches like New Panvel in Thane.
For example, the IFSC Code BARB0VJNPAN of Bank Of Baroda for the New Panvel branch has these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Thane and Maharashtra correctly.

How to Use IFSC Code BARB0VJNPAN for Online Transfers?
Once you have the IFSC Code BARB0VJNPAN for the New Panvel branch of Bank Of Baroda in Thane, you can initiate your f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add the beneficiary's name, account number, and IFSC Code BARB0VJNPAN. The transfer is completed in batches. It is useful for both person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for payments over 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. Requires the recipient's account details and Bank Of Baroda IFSC Code BARB0VJNPAN.
No matter which payment method you use, the IFSC Code must be correct. If you enter the wrong IFSC Code for the Bank Of Baroda New Panvel in Thane, your payment can get delayed or might not go through at all.
